Once again, what is an award show without Kanye West? The controversial artist took to the stage to end the 2010 VMAs with style tonight. Introducing a new single that is directed at all of the assholes and scumbags of the world. The name of the single is Runaway. And he dedicated the performance to his mother for some odd reason.

Nevertheless, Kanye brought his one of a kind energy. He drew off the reaction of the crowd to powerfully string bar after bar including this interesting chorus.

“Let’s have a toast for the a**holes/ Let’s have a toast for the d*****bags/ Let’s have a toast for the scumbags, every one of them that I know/ Let’s have a toast for the jerk-offs that’ll never take work off/ Baby I gotta plan, run away fast as you can.”

Finally ending his performance with the crowd chanting “Kanye” as the 2010 VMAs went off air.

Everyone remembers last year, when Kanye took the trophy from Taylor Swift (who by the way dedicated a melody to him earlier in the night). Much has went on in his life since that idiotic mistake. Basically he decided to leave the limelight for a good part of the last year. I don’t know if that was more of a PR decision, maybe just a reevaluation of his career, but its evident that Mr. West is back.

Dark Twisted Fantasy, West’s next album, is expected to be released on November 16th of this year. The first single Power leaked back in May, but was officially released on iTunes in June.
